Mercantilism held that government should promote the intrnal economy in order to improve tax revenues and to limit imports from other nations. The exodus of 1879, also known as the kansas exodus or the exoduster movement, was the mass movement of african americans from states along the mississippi river to kansas in the late nineteenth century.
